Here's what works.
Jojo's Fashion Show 2: Las Cruces -
Design outrageous outfit combos for the runway. This sequel boosts more
clothes and more characters than the first. If you have no style, you can
hide it with flamboyant combinations...just like the real designers do.
The Lost Cases of Sherlock Holmes -
Espionage, murder, and theft... keep the drama out of your holiday season and
let this game create all the suspense you need.
Chocolatier 2: Secret Ingredients- A
simulation that involves earning lots of money and chocolate. With that
combo, can you really go wrong?
Mystery Case Files: Madame Fate - Let's
face it, carnival people are pretty creepy as it is... then add bizarre
murders, dark humor, and some great graphics. There's a reason these sequels
are so popular.
Fishdom - It's part match 3,
and part fish simulation. The best part is you never have to clean the tank.
Jewel Quest III - Outrageously
challenging and fast paced, with some killer graphics. Move over, Bejewelled.
Cake Mania 3- More frantic cake baking,
while traveling through time and space. Far fetched? Yes, but completely
addictive.
Build-a-lot 2: Town of the Year - Civil
engineering was never so much fun! Plan neighborhoods and paint houses while
the mayor gushes over your brilliance.
Virtual Villagers: The Secret City - The
Secret City - It's not reality television, but it is real time gaming on a
desert island. The little guys can reproduce, grow old, and die if you leave
them along for too long.
Women's Murder Club - Death in Scarlet -
Search for blood stains, examine corpses, harass suspects, and find creative
ways to bend the law. Now that's realism! It's based on James Patterson's WMC
series.

Here's what doesn't work.
The Sims Carnival SnapCity-
It has nothing to do with the Sims, other than being produced by the same
company. Basically, this is Tetris using city parts. I expected so much more
from EA!
Fashion Dash - It's just
like Diner Dash...except with bugs, and not much original content. Skip this
one and play Fitness Dash or Parking Lot Dash instead.
Daycare Nightmare: Mini-Monsters
- It's exactly the same as the first, except with 3D graphics. Same monsters,
same plot, same mechanics. I think the animated version was better...
7 Wonders: Treasures of Seven -
The game play is slow, and it never gets challenging. The rotating board was
an original idea, but it makes things too easy for most players.
Ice Cream Tycoon - Monotonous. I know tycoon games are supposed
to simulate a business experience, but it shouldn't feel like actual work!
Interpol 2: Most Wanted -
Great graphics, but the story drags on and never gets off the ground. The
clicks are often unresponsive, which makes things worse.
Stand O'Food 2- Too many
bugs, with unusual graphics and characters. The food choices have gotten
better, but the experience was still pretty awkward.
Bejeweled Twist --
Come on, this is Bejwelled we're talking about! Expectations are pretty high.
This sequel no different from earlier versions, and you have to start over
from the beginning when you die. If you already own a Bejewelled title, don't
expect anything new here.
